WebThe null hypothesis of this test can be very difficult to understand, but assumes that the two groups being compared were sampled from populations with identical distributions. This test uses the cumulative distributions of the data to test for any violation of this null hypothesis (different medians, different variances, or different ...

Web2 feb. 2024 · Two of them are categorical and I'll a use Chi-squared test for the head-count while one y is a continuous variable: Reinvestment Value. the four groups and statistics with respect to the continuous y are: Control group: n=2749 I don't have the statistics yet Treatment A n=624, mean=3413.9 s2=30269139.5 sd=5501.7, k=12, sk=3.1 Web4 nov. 2024 · One-tailed hypothesis tests are also known as directional and one-sided tests because you can test for effects in only one direction. When you perform a one-tailed test, the entire significance level percentage goes into the extreme end of one tail of the distribution. In the examples below, I use an alpha of 5%.
